Menasukayi is a spicy, tangy, and sweet side dish for rice!! This is very popular in the southern part of Karnataka. Raw mango is called Mavinkayi in Kannada. You can also prepare this with pineapple, bitter gourd, hog palms.

Ingredients
1 cup raw mango cut into chunks
Jaggery to taste
Salt to taste
For masala:
1/2 tsp coriander seeds
3 tsp urad dal
2 tsp sesame seeds
4 methi seeds(fenugreek)
4 red chillies
2 tsp grated coconut
In 2 tsp oil roast coriander seeds, methi, urad dal and sesame seeds into brown colour and keep. In the same Kadai roast, red chillies and coconut and grind all roasted ingredients to a fine paste.
For tempering:
2 tsp oil
1 tsp mustard
1 sprig of curry leaves
Procedure
In a vessel take mango pieces, add 1/2 cup water, salt and cook till it becomes a little soft
Add jaggery to taste, ground masala and boil it
Temper with the ingredients and serve with rice.
